The Rolling Stones touched down in Sydney for their second Australasian tour on February 16th 1966. Although the local press was hostile, they turned in some typically exciting shows in front of hysterical crowds, showcasing both their early material and more recent, selfpenned tracks including their latest release, 19th Nervous Breakdown. This set presents two shows ndash in Sydney and Melbourne ndash alongside their press conference upon arrival and a radio interview.
